Okay here's how i got my Warrior Mac Daddy from an American store. I emailed a few stores one of which was hockey monkey and all the american stores told me We(the store) arn't aloud to ship warrior products to Canada, I thought this was strange and that it really didn't make much sense, so I emailed warrior and asked them what was up? I got an email back from warrior saying we never tell anyone where they can and can't ship, once a company buys from us it's their's, they can do what they want with it. So i emailed back the store i wanted to buy my stick from and told them this is what warrior said to me, and basically i called the store out on it. The store then said forward the email from warrior to us, so I did that and then the store said oh i guess we are aloud to send one to you then since warrior gave you permission, and they sent it, got it last week
